Edgar Cayce was a man of humble beginnings, born in rural Kentucky in 1877. His journey towards becoming a renowned psychic and healer was not a straightforward one. It was marked by a series of mystical experiences and intuitive insights that led him to develop a unique approach to health and wellness. Cayce's contributions to the field of holistic health are significant, as he introduced a new way of understanding and treating illness that was revolutionary for his time. Holistic health, as the name suggests, is an approach to health that considers the whole person - body, mind, and spirit - in the quest for optimal health and wellness. Cayce's approach to holistic health was unique in that it incorporated elements of spirituality, natural medicine, and intuitive insight. He believed that health was not just about the physical body but also about the mind and spirit. This was a revolutionary concept at a time when medicine was primarily focused on treating physical symptoms. The principles behind Cayce's remedies are rooted in the concept of the interconnectedness of body, mind, and spirit. He believed that illness was not just a physical phenomenon but a manifestation of imbalances in the body, mind, and spirit. Therefore, his remedies aimed to address the root cause of an illness rather than just treating the symptoms. This involved the use of natural medicines and spiritual practices to restore balance and promote healing. About William A. McGarey
William A. McGarey was a renowned physician and pioneer in holistic medicine. He co-founded the A.R.E. Clinic in Arizona and the Meridian Institute, both dedicated to the study and application of the Edgar Cayce readings. He authored several books on holistic health and spirituality.
